Specificity / Sensitivity
PPAR delta (E8O3H) Rabbit Monoclonal Antibody recognizes endogenous levels of total PPARδ protein. This antibody may cross-react with overexpressed PPARα protein.
Species Reactivity: Human, Mouse, Rat, Monkey
Source / Purification
Monoclonal antibody is produced by immunizing animals with a recombinant protein fragment specific to human PPARδ protein.
Background
Peroxisome proliferator-activated receptor-δ (PPARδ, also known as PPARβ or PPARβ/δ) is a widely expressed member of the PPAR nuclear receptor family, which controls lipid homeostasis (1,2). In response to various ligands, PPAR proteins heterodimerize with retinoid X receptors (RXRs) in order to bind DNA and regulate target genes (3,4). PPARδ plays a role in many different biological functions, including cholesterol efflux, embryo implantation, preadipocyte proliferation, and wound healing (5-8). PPARδ has been implicated in colorectal cancer (CRC), as it is normally downregulated by APC, a tumor suppressor frequently knocked out in CRCs (9). More recently, high fat diets have been found to induce PPARδ in intestinal stem cells and progenitors, increasing their tumorigenicity (10). Furthermore, in Huntington's disease (HD) mouse models, it was shown that PPARδ was unable bind to huntingtin protein when mutated, which repressed its function. Agonist-induced activation of PPARδ in HD model mice improved cognitive function and increased survival time (11).
